Originally Posted by SiLVeRE8
I have a virgin trunk and im wondering if it is easy to install the wing yourself instead of bringing it to the shop. and if i bring it to a shop, does anyone know how much would it cost for labor?
Very easy, the true MS wing will come with two paper templates that you cut out with scissors, then tape to you trunk lid to mark the hole locations. Just two holes on each side, and it should take you about an hour to get everything done. Really nothing difficult about the install, as long as you can read and have patience. After drilling the holes, you will mount the metal risers. Then you'll place the lower portion of the wing, taping it to the trunk. The directions will tell you how to mkae sure its lined up (basically, you dry fit the lower portion...put a piece of blue painters tape on your trunk, near the third brake light, and a piece above that, on the lower portion of the wing. Take a pen and mark a line on both pieces of tape so that they make one solid line from top tape to bottom tape. Remove the lower portion, peel of the tape, and reattached...using the blue tapes to help you make the lines match again). Attaching the top portion of the wing is the easiest part. Have fun.

If you have the ability to do it yourself, I say go for it. When you are going to drill the holes, just make sure you use a punch of something to mark where you want to drill...would hate to see that drill bit slip and scratch up the trunk.
